Anyway, the site’s creators, Mike Bender and Doug Chernack, developed a screenplay called Sterling and Warner Bros. went for it. As reported by THR, plot info is being concealed, but you can expect to get a high-concept action-comedy. Chuck Roven and Alex Gartner of Atlas Entertainment will produce while Sarah Schechter keeps an eye on the project for the studio.

Other than the website, you may recall Bender’s work on the MTV Movie Awards or on Not Another Teen Movie. Back in 2006, New Line Cinema picked up the rights to the Spanish dark comedy Torrente and hired Bender and Chernack to pen an English-language remake, but there’s been no update on the project since. Odds are we won’t hear much more about that or Sterling for some time, so keep an eye out for a book based on awkwardfamilyphotos.com hitting stores on May 4th.
